I had another thought on the buffer 33... Doing a little digging through the docs, it appears that the hardware only started supporting 34 vertex buffers on Sky Lake but it has supported 34 vertex elements since Ivy Bridge or even earlier. If we were somehow able to use the same buffer for DrawID as we did for BaseVertex and BaseInstance, we could keep the limit at 32. I'm not seeing any real good way to do that in the indirect draw case so let's go ahead and drop the limit to 31 for now and figure out how to be more clever later.

Just gave a try to buffer 33 on Kabylake, that didn't work :(
So I think we're stuck with 31 for now.
